After inspecting the engine bores the pitting in 2 of the bores is beyond honing out, so I am going to have to have it bored oversize... so I got hold of a set of low mileage LS1 pistons and rods and will be having the block bored to 99mm from 97. Apparently the walls are thick enough to support it. It was cheaper to buy the LS1 pistons than a set of basic oversize ones.
I plan on dropping it off at the machine shop in the next few weeks, but until then I am getting the other parts cleaned up and rebuilt ready to refit.
So I started cleaning up the heads first
Fitted LS6 springs as I plan on putting a mild cam in the motor. I also gave them a good wash, cleaned all of the ports out and lapped the valves although there was very little wear on the seats.
Got one finished, I'll do the other one tomorrow.
